1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the process of simplifying an expression by combining like terms?

Back

Combining like terms involves adding or subtracting coefficients of terms that have the same variable raised to the same power.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you factor an expression like 10 + 20n?

Back

To factor the expression, identify the greatest common factor (GCF), which is 10 in this case, and rewrite the expression as 10(1 + 2n).

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the result of simplifying the expression 6w - 6w + 6w + 9w?

Back

The result is 15w, as the like terms combine to give 15w.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you express 'the sum of 6 and 5 doubled' mathematically?

Back

It can be expressed as 2 x (6 + 5).

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the expanded form of the expression 3(2c - 5)?

Back

The expanded form is 6c - 15.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What are like terms in an algebraic expression?

Back

Like terms are terms that have the same variable raised to the same power, allowing them to be combined.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the distributive property in algebra?

Back

The distributive property states that a(b + c) = ab + ac, allowing you to multiply a single term by each term inside a parenthesis.
